Daher Tbm 960 vs Dassault Falcon 8x vs Embraer Legacy 650 E vs Md Helicopters (mcdonnell Douglas) 902 Explorer
The Daher TBM 960 is a single‑engine turboprop aimed at owner‑pilots and efficient point‑to‑point travel. It typically carries about 4–6 passengers in a pressurized cabin (depending on configuration) and offers roughly 1,500–1,700 nautical miles of range, trading ultimate speed and cabin volume for lower operating cost and access to shorter runways. The Dassault Falcon 8X is a long‑range, large‑cabin tri‑jet designed for intercontinental missions. It commonly seats around 12–16 passengers and delivers about 6,400 nautical miles of range, emphasizing global reach, high cruise speeds, and a premium cabin. The Embraer Legacy 650E is a super‑midsize/large‑cabin business jet optimized for longer regional and transoceanic legs. It typically accommodates about 13 passengers and provides roughly 3,900–4,000 nautical miles of range, balancing cabin comfort with strong range and economics versus ultra‑long‑range jets. The MD Helicopters (McDonnell Douglas) MD 902 Explorer is a twin‑engine helicopter for short‑range missions such as EMS, law enforcement, and utility transport. It usually carries about 1–7 passengers and has a range around 300–400 nautical miles, prioritizing vertical access over speed and distance.
